Product Lifecycle Management in support of green manufacturing: addressing the challenges of global climate change

چکیده

Across the globe, more companies are pursuing economically viable green manufacturing in order to efficiently reduce or eliminate pollutants and hazardous substances. Companies are seeing the economic impact of green manufacturing because it creates sustainable development, allows opportunity for re-investment, supports cost saving strategies, and has a positive impact on the bottom line. These benefits support many strategic initiatives and provide a competitive advantage. In order to implement green processes and products, companies exploit product lifecycle management (PLM) practices to achieve their strategic initiatives. PLM is a process that focuses on managing a product through its entire lifecycle, from the conception to the disposal or recycle of the product. PLM helps a business reduce the use of time, materials, and energy by using a shared information core. International laws and standards have a direct effect on the product lifecycle. Through the PLM information core, companies can integrate environmentally friendly practices into their business. The focus of this paper is to investigate why companies practice green manufacturing and how PLM supports environmentally friendly initiatives. The investigated companies are taken from the Global Round Table on Climate Change. In particular, this paper examines how PLM drives green manufacturing to improve environmental performance while meeting financial and long-term sustainability. Mechanisms to increase energy efficiency, de-carbonization, reduction of harmful emissions, and better land management practices such as reducing landfill waste will be studied. This paper also includes a review of interviews and examples from previous studies.
